WSFA Award Announced

The Washington Science Fiction Association has established a literary award to honor the work done by small presses in promoting and preserving science fiction.

In Memoriam: Brian Jacques

British author Brian Jacques (b.June 15, 1939) died on February 5, 2011 following emergency surgery for an aortic aneurysm. Jacques published his juvenile novel Redwall, about a collection of anthropomorphic mice, badgers, voles, and other creatures, in 1986.
